
TMC RESEARCH CORPORATION

PAT48PR

Processor             80486SX/80487SX/80486DX/ODP486SX/80486DX2
Processor Speed       25/33/50(internal)/50/66(internal)MHz
Chip Set              OPTI
Max. Onboard DRAM     64MB
SRAM Cache            64/128/256KB
BIOS                  AMI
Dimensions            220mm x 240mm
I/O Options           32-bit VESA local bus slot (2)
NPU Options           None

                        USER CONFIGURABLE SETTINGS

                Function                      Jumper         Position

     CMOS memory normal operation             JP1           pins 2 & 3
      (internal battery)                                      closed

     CMOS memory normal operation             JP1             open
      (external battery)

      CMOS memory clear                        JP1           pins 1 & 2
                                                              closed

     Monitor type select color                JP4            closed

      Monitor type select monochrome           JP4             open

                            SRAM CONFIGURATION

     Size          Cache         Location      TAG(U43)       TAG(U44)

     64KB        (8) 8K x 8    Banks 0 & 1    (1) 8K x 8     (1) 64K x 1

     128KB      (4) 32K x 8       Bank 0      (1) 8K x 8     (1) 64K x 1

     256KB      (8) 32K x 8    Banks 0 & 1    (1) 32K x 8    (1) 64K x 1

      SRAM RESISTOR CONFIGURATION

   Size      RND       RNE       RNF

   64KB     closed    open      open

  128KB      open    closed     open

  256KB      open     open     closed

           CPU JUMPER CONFIGURATION

    CPU        RNA3        RNB3        RNC3

  80486DX2    closed       open        open

  ODP486SX     open       closed       open

  80486DX     closed       open        open

  80487SX      open       closed       open

  80486SX      open        open       closed

                 VESA CARDS SUPPORTED JUMPER CONFIGURATION

  # of VESA cards          W21                W22               W23

        2                closed             closed           pins 1 & 2
                                                              closed

        1            W21/pin 1 connected to W22/pin1         pins 2 & 3
                                                               closed

  Note: The manufacturer recommends that only one VESA card be used with
  a 486DX-50MHz.

                      CPU SPEED JUMPER CONFIGURATION

    CPU       JP2     JP3      JP5 &     W13     W14      W15       W16
                                JP6

   25MHz      pins    pins     open      open    open   closed     open
             2 & 3    1 & 2

   33MHz      pins    pins     open      open    open    open     closed
             2 & 3    1 & 2

  50iMHz      pins    pins     open      open    open   closed     open
             2 & 3    1 & 2

   50MHz      pins    pins    closed     open    open   closed     open
             1 & 2    2 & 3

  66iMHz      pins    pins     open      open    open    open     closed
             2 & 3    1 & 2

  Note:W13 - W16 need only be configured if a 20-pin clock generator is
  installed in U29.

  JP3 is AT bus clock select.

  JP5 and JP6 are VESA bus clock select.

  Pins designated are in the closed position.
